White Dwarf is the official Warhammer magazine, packed with amazing monthly content – including new rules and background, short stories, regular columns, special guests, and more.
Here’s what you can look forward to in the December issue:
Planet Warhammer
Models, letters, and questions sent in by readers. Plus, a bloomin’ big dragon!
WARHAMMER QUEST: DARKWATER
A New Quest
John is our guide on a deep (dark, dank) dive into the rules of Warhammer Quest: Darkwater.
Of Heroes and Villains
A new cast of questors – and their loathsome adversaries – await! The designers reveal all.
Paint Splatter
Emily paints our bold heroes up all nice. Shame they're about to plunge into the muck.
Battle Report: Breach The Abbey
Stop me if you've heard this one: two knights, a duardin, and a mage walk into an abbey…
WARHAMMER 40,000
New Year, New Army
Which army will you lead into the grim, dark future of M3.26? Let our flow chart decide…
New Army, New Story
A smorgasbord of imagination-sparking prompts for your new army's epic narrative.
Escalating Conflict
Ready to step up from patrol to incursion? We've got some tips on expanding your forces.
Galactic War Hosts: Astra Militarum
It's a regular regimental parade, as the studio's Astra Militarum armies roll out in force.
The Golden Throne
Ever wondered how the Master of Mankind's favourite piece of furniture works? Yeah, us too.
WARHAMMER AGE OF SIGMAR
Brush Tips
The ’Eavy Metal ’elsmiths are ’ere (eh?) to talk us through the Zharrdron’s paint schemes.
A Tale of Four Warlords
Two challenges in and the points are racking up. What’s the latest news from our warlords?
OTHER ARTICLES
Access Granted!
Here you will find painting challenges and the latest Bunker news.
Festive Grotto
A veritable banquet of seasonally appropriate minis! The pudding looks a bit dodgy, though.
The Vanishing of the Emberwing
News from the studio's Ravaged Coast campaign. Warning: may contain emberstone.
Bunker Bingo!
Have the team stuck to this year's hobby resolutions? And what will their new ones be?
Each copy of White Dwarf 519 also comes with a double-sided card featuring the Warhammer 40,000 and Warhammer Age of Sigmar Scenarios of the Month. This issue also includes a 2026 Bunker Bingo card to track your hobby progress over 2026.
